- The F.A. Girls have finished setting up a room for Architect in the empty space of the bookshelf that they're currently staying in. Ao prepares to go to a fireworks festival, but is met with opposition from Jinrai, who believes she shouldn't wear underwear under her kimono. Although the resulting commotion leads Ao to miss the festival, she gets to watch them on the roof with the F.A. Girls. Later, as Ao attempts to finish her summer homework at the last minute, the F.A. Girls are tasked with fetching her notebook from school at night, providing Baselard and the Materia Sisters with an opportunity to scare them by pretending to be ghosts. However, the girls soon become the target of a haunted pair of nippers , which manages to fulfil its goal by snipping a leftover fragment off of Gourai's armor. As they head home with the notebook and the nippers, the ghost girl who possessed the nippers watches them leave. Meanwhile, Bukiko tells Ao a scary story about a ghost of a young girl who haunts her school, which is the same ghost that the F.A. Girls encountered. (en)
- Baselard decides to follow Ao to school, prompting Gourai and Stylet to chase after her. Ao's model-kit obsessed friend, Kotobuki Bukiko, discovers the F.A. Girls and joins them and Ao in tracking down Baselard as she starts stealing shiny things from the school. Bukiko helps them catch Baselard using a pair of shiny nippers to lure her in. Later, two more F.A. girls known as the Materia sisters arrive and challenge Gourai and Stylet to a battle, but the latter two are having trouble working together. As the Materia sisters prove overwhelming even without any armor, Ao gives Gourai a weapon she received from Bukiko, which successfully manages to defeat the sisters thanks to Stylet's support. The sister decide to stay with Ao, to Stylet's dismay. (en)
- Another F.A. Girl named Jinrai comes to Ao's place to battle against Gourai as Ao is planning her summer vacation. Gourai agrees as Jinrai won't take no for an answer. After Gourai beats her once, Jinrai proposes a sumo match, only to lose that as well. Ao gets frustrated when they still want to fight. Later, after being forced to clean up a mess they made, the girls are given their own miniature rooms to decorate, leaving only one empty space. As each of the girls work hard to make their own personal rooms, the Materia sisters use almost all of Ao's savings for their own dollhouse room. This upsets Ao, who proceeds to chase them down. (en)
- As Gourai becomes paranoid over Hresvelgr's threats, Ao visits Hresvelgr at Factory Advance to try and understand why she wants to battle against Gourai. She explains that she is testing Gourai in order to get her to improve her skills, as she too wishes to stay with Ao due to her loneliness. She later receives a message from Factory Advance for an upgrade. Later, Ao and Bukiko go to a public bath while the F.A. Girls go to their own virtual public bath via their Session Bases. Afterwards, Hresvelgr appears in a frightening upgraded form, Hresvelgr-Ater, to once again face Gourai, notably having a different appearance and lacking the joy of battles she had previously shown. However, Hresvelgr's upgrades start to overflow, causing her to go berserk and lose control of herself. (en)
- Ao holds a hot pot party, but the F.A. Girls can't agree on what kind of hot pot to have. Upon having her hot pot, Ao inadvertently breaks one of the Session Bases used for battles after mistaking it for a hot pot stand. Just then, Hresvelger shows up to challenge Gourai to another battle, revealing that all the F.A. Girls will be recalled to Factory Advance should Gourai lose, meaning that the company might end their business with Ao. Angered by Hresvelgr's treatment of Ao, Gourai launches a powerful attack to clash against hers, resulting in a power cut that forces the match into a draw. Hresvelger again leaves after the battle. - Spurred on by Ao's wish to help free Hresvelgr from her corruption, the other F.A. Girls send all of their weapons to Gourai to help her fight the berserk Hresvelgr, since the powerful energy from the battle prevents them from personally helping. With everyone's combined strength, Gourai manages to win the battle and put a stop to Hresvelgr's rampage, who then returns to her senses. The battle also causes another power outage. Shortly afterwards, Gourai is taken by a recall drone back to Factory Advance, with Ao and the now-benevolent Hresvelgr unsuccessfully trying to stop it. Luckily, she quickly returns as it turns out to be a temporary recall for maintenance. She had also brought back a new fuse sent by Factory Advance to restore power to the apartment. Factory Advance also sends Ao an email to apologize for accidentally corrupting Hresvelgr with her new upgrade and allows Gourai to permanently stay with her. Later, on Christmas Eve, Ao holds a Christmas party to welcome Hresvelgr to the family, during which Gourai asks Ao to share her surname. Wanting surnames of their own, the other F.A. Girls decide to set off in search of their own special partners, holding a live show for Ao as a send-off. Ao hopes that they will return someday. Meanwhile, another F.A. Girl named Innocentia is in development at Factory Advance. (en)
- Ao ends up catching a cold, prompting the F.A. Girls to go to extreme lengths to figure out how to treat her. When their various methods only make things worse, Gourai learns to consider Ao's feelings and ask her how best to care for her. While resting from her cold, Ao has a dream in which Gourai and the other F.A. Girls are all regular human girls who go to school with her. After waking up from dream, she is fully recovered, but discovers that the F.A. Girls appeared to have the same dream as her and have caught her cold, which should not be possible since they are robots. Ao decides to take care of them now. (en)
- As Stylet acts strangely stiff whenever Gourai comes close to her, she assumes that some trauma is causing her to be unable to fly. After Gourai tries administering some shock therapy by kissing Stylet, Ao discovers that she had accidentally stepped on one of Stylet's parts the previous night. After fixing it, she regains her ability to fly. Later, Ao receives a seemingly broken cleaning robot from the building manager, which ends up recording the F.A. Girls as they talk about Ao's embarrassing secrets. The robot then comes alive and wrecks havoc in the apartment. After Baselard breaks the robot to keep it quiet, she faces Gourai in a battle to pay Ao back, but loses due to the dust from the cleaning robot. The building manager later sends Ao a vacuum cleaner as a temporally replacement for the defective cleaning robot. (en)
- After a successful test of Gourai's new parts, the F.A. Girls hold a pep rally for Gourai in preparation for a rematch against Hresvelgr, with Architect acting as the latter. Later, as Autumn rolls in, Ao takes Gourai to the park where she used to go as a kid. There, they come across a girl named Guriko, who leads them to a time capsule Ao had buried containing some mementos, including the Guriko doll she used to have. Guriko then vanishes, indicating that she was merely a vision. (en)
- Architect, an F.A. Girl without a physical body, intrudes on Gourai and Jinrai's battle, attacking with clones and pre-programmed subroutines that adapt to the situation. After Gourai and Jinrai manage to win the battle, Architect experiences an error in her programming, which Gourai manages to fix with her act of friendship. Afterwards, Architect receives a physical body and is delivered to Ao's place. Later, as the cleaning robot is fixed and upgraded by Bukiko and given the name Sleipni-taro, the F.A. Girls decide to use it as transportation. They then hold a race to buy some vinegar for Ao, involving four teams: Gourai and Jinrai riding Sleipni-taro, the Materia sisters riding one of Factory Advance's drones, and Stylet and Baselard; Architect is on her own. Each team faces their own troubles: Gourai and Jinrai crash in a playground and are stuck in a sandstorm caused by Sleipni-taro, Stylet and Baselard are knocked into a field by the Materia sisters where they are licked by goats , and the sisters crash into a tree. Architect does not face any trouble and manages to buy the vinegar. (en)
- While the F.A. Girls play a game of hide-and-seek, Hresvelgr, the self-proclaimed "strongest F.A. Girl", arrives to face Gourai in a battle, managing to completely defeat her. She leaves afterwards. As Gourai feels frustrated over her loss, Ao asks Bukiko about how F.A. Girls are made, helping Gouri to better understand herself and aim to become stronger. After Ao sends in a report, Factory Advance sends her boxloads of new parts to upgrade Gourai. (en)
